Clinical Research Coordinator-2, Non-Licensed (CRC-2, NL), is a role that requires some previous experience in clinical research. A CRC 2 will be able to manage the basic elements of clinical trial conduct and demonstrate a solid understanding of clinical research compliance. CRC2 will be involved in most aspects of clinical research conduct and will continue to benefit from the opportunity to engage in additional on-the-job training and mentorship opportunities to continue to advance on the clinical research career path. A CRC2 works under the moderate supervision of a Principal Investigator and/or an experienced CRC and will manage a reasonable portfolio of clinical trials or research projects as assigned by a supervisor.

Responsibilities:
  • Work closely with Principal Investigators and other study team members on all clinical research projects assigned.
  • Become familiar with study start-up processes and requirements for: non-disclosure agreements, data use and material transfer agreements, clinical trial agreements, development of clinical trial budgets.
  • Manage study recruitment and enrollment efforts including: screen and identify eligible patients, obtain and document informed consent and enrollment.
  • Manage ongoing study conduct activities such as: schedule and coordinate study visits, maintain concomitant medication records, track and report adverse events, organize subject study payments.
  • Collect and enter study data in a timely fashion, maintain corresponding documentation
  • Collect, process, store and ship study specimens as needed.
  • Assist in preparation, maintenance or creation of study documents such as: study visit schedules, study drug diaries, monitoring or training logs, equipment records or study communications.
  • Prepare and submit all regulatory documentation to the IRB such as: personnel changes, annual protocol continuations, protocol modifications, adverse event reports, unanticipated events.
  • Document and report protocol deviations.
  • Reconcile study billing, identify charges covered by the study, versus charges to be billed to the subject/third party payor.
  • Confirm Sponsor is invoiced for study activity.
  • Notify PI and/or supervisor of any potential issues with the study or subject status.
  • Communicate effectively with study Sponsor(s.)
  • Proficient user of the various electronic platforms utilized in clinical research such as: IRB Pro, Protocol Builder, CRConnect, OnCore, e-regulatory platforms and Epic.
  • Demonstrate a continuously increasing level of clinical research knowledge gained through active participation in training and mentorship opportunities as well as self-guided learning.
